Assam filmmaker Rima Das adds another feather to her cap. Das has joined Toronto International Film Festival’s ‘Share Her Journey’ as its official ambassador.

The ‘Share Her Journey’ campaign by TIFF was launched in the year 2017 with a view to increase and encourage participation, skills and prospects for women behind and in front of the camera.

Artistic director and co-head of TIFF Cameron Bailey said that the TIFF is thrilled to welcome Das on board as an Ambassador for their ‘Share Her Journey’ campaign and that Rima’s remarkable body of work and passion for championing equality makes her an excellent choice to help the campaign support women in film and move the dial towards gender equality throughout the industry.

The ‘Village Rockstars’ Director said that she would like to see more women in the industry and would like to bring together voices of people of all genders and work together to work for the cause of equality in the society.

The other Indian ambassadors of the campaign include Mira Nair, Deepa Mehta and Priyanka Chopra.
